Sign In — Free (10 views/day)KINGS UNITED WAY, founded in 1961, is a community nonprofit in the Philanthropy & Grantmaking sector that reported $1.2M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ue surged 38%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Expenses of $1.0M left a modest 13% surplus.
IT'S PURPOSE IS TO SOLICIT DONATIONS FROM RESIDENTS AND COMPANIES LOCATED IN KINGS COUNTY TO BENEFIT LOCAL CHARITABLE ORGANIZATIONS.
ALLOCATIONS TO CHARITABLE ORGANIZATIONS, PROVIDE ASSISTANCE AND GUIDANCE TO MANAGEMENT OF NONPROFITS, FUNDRAISING AND SPECIAL PROJECTS
